Transaction 40cc01e64971cceb9f32aeef24b99337a440cdfb828d2943cad9150a4ea12634
1 Input
1 Output
-
40cc01e64971cceb9f32aeef24b99337a440cdfb828d2943cad9150a4ea12634:0
- value
- 51239155
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 895f71be7d17082e73d2bf5154c7915fa24c402e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DXMusLZuLgPvV5wc9ncHFdcaRf7meCBgr